'They Lost Everything': GoFundMe Created For Port Washington Family Displaced In House Fire
No injuries were reported, but the house was deemed uninhabitable, fire marshals say.
PORT WASHINGTON, NY — A GoFundMe has been launched to support the three residents displaced in a Port Washington house fire on Thursday.
The fire left the home uninhabitable, and no injuries to the three adult occupants were reported, fire marshals said.
According to fire marshals, Nassau County Firecom received 911 calls reporting a house fire at 7:13 p.m. on Thursday. There were 50 firefighters at the scene, fire marshals said.

Friends of Melissa Freda organized the GoFundMe, which has raised over $3K.
The organizer shared on the page: "Hi everyone, I'm reaching out with a heavy heart to ask for your help. On Thursday, December 11th, our friend Melissa Freda Hillie and her parents' home was tragically destroyed in a fire. Thankfully, everyone made it out safely, but they lost everything."

She added that the family is in need of assistance from their community.
"The funds will go toward immediate housing and basic needs. Any amount makes a difference. Thank you for your support."
